I is for Illusion is the ninth episode of season 2, and the thirty-fifth episode overall of the TV series.

Plot[]

The girls went on a vacation with Irma's family, and the girls had a bit of a rough time there, but they managed to cope with it, until Nerissa showed up and began spreading distrust amongst them. Nerissa successfully framed Will as applying her power of quintessence into inanimate objects.

Later on, one of the objects moved outside their residence and the gang started arguing. Suddenly, "The Oracle" appeared claiming to want to reclaim their powers because of distrust and absence of harmony and demanding that Will hand over the Heart of Kandrakar.

Fortunately, Hay Lin noticed that the Oracle had a different shadow: it's "The Old Hag"! This prompted the Guardians to transform and a battle ensued with Caleb and Blunk from Meridian to help out, and victory went to the Guardians as they defeated the inanimate objects brought to life and restored their bond as friends and their group harmony.

In the B-story, Caleb and Blunk were fighting with the other Knights of Vengeance.

Release notes[]

  • All known DVD versions of this episode are noticeably overexposed, with significantly brighter video throughout than in any other episode. This is particularly apparent in the opening sequence and closing credits, perhaps because they can be compared directly.

Comics connections[]

  • This episode bears similarities to issue 16 of the comics, with the W.I.T.C.H. girls going on vacation and having it ruined by Nerissa's evil acts.
  • The part where Will almost gave Nerissa (disguised as the Oracle) the Heart of Kandrakar is similar to an event that occurred in issue 20, where Will actually did give Nerissa (disguised as Matt) the Heart of Kandrakar.

Trivia[]

  • Every second-season episode has a clear focus on one of the five main characters. This episode is one of 5 in the season to focus on Irma Lair.
  • Irma continued to stay at the same house on vacation in the following episode, as Blunk folded to her there to help defeat Phobos.
  • All of the girls seemed annoyed and surprised that Hay Lin snores in her sleep. As this is far from their first sleepover in the series, they should have already known this, unless it is a recent development.
  • In the surfing montage, an instrumental track can be heard which sounds a lot like the song "Romp Bomp A Stomp" by The Wiggles. This is likely because The Wiggles had a contract with the show's co-producer and distributor, Disney, at the time.
  • Cornelia said she couldn't swim in The Underwater Mines, but swam just fine while they were playing in the water. It's possible she since learned how in the time between this episode and the former.
